Carnival warns guests over tiger cub encounters

Cruise operator Carnival is warning its guests against tiger cub petting, an activity on offer at some ports it docks at.

A letter written by ship captain Eduardo Ferrone on a stop off at Ensenada, Mexico, warned against tiger petting attractions, which Carnival does not have on its official activities list.

“As you get ready for our visit to Ensenada, we have an important advisory,” the letter reads.

“You may encounter restaurants/attractions (not associated with the ship's shore excursions program) in the port of Ensenada that allow you to touch or otherwise interact with tiger cubs. For public health, safety, and environmental reasons, Carnival recommends that you do not partake in such attractions, including, but not limited to, tiger cub attractions.”
